praseodymium

pra·seo·dy·mium

UK/ˌpɹeɪzioʊˈdɪmiəm/ US/ˌpreɪziːəˈdɪmiəm/ uncommon

noun

1.

a soft yellowish-white trivalent metallic element of the rare earth group; can be recovered from bastnasite or monazite by an ion-exchange process

Origin

From Ancient Greek πράσιος (prásios, “leek-green”) + didymium.
